Understanding Your Contract Dispute


Contract law comes with terms that aren't always obvious. Below are some of the terms you may come across during a contract dispute:


  • Breach of Contract – when one party fails to meet the obligations they agreed to under the terms of a contract.
  • Material Breach – a serious failure to perform that defeats the core purpose of the agreement and may allow the other party to end the contract and seek damages.
  • Damages – the monetary compensation awarded to the party harmed by a breach, meant to cover the losses they suffered.
  • Specific Performance – a court order requiring the breaching party to actually carry out their end of the agreement, used when money alone can't make things right.
  • Liquidated Damages – a set amount of compensation written into the contract in advance, to be paid if a specific breach occurs.
  • Rescission – the cancellation of a contract, which returns both parties to the position they were in before the agreement was made.
